TRAVELING TO MEXICO?

As of January 2008, Mexico no longer requires permits for boats engaging in sport-fishing in Mexican waters. However, fishing licenses and crew lists are still mandatory. If you have any type of fishing gear aboard your boat, you must purchase a fishing license for each person on the boat.

Watercraft Liability Insurance coverage is extremely important, as well, while traveling in Mexican territorial waters, inland lakes and rivers.

» As of October 1, 2001, the American Fisheries Act has been implemented. This new Act dramatically changes the citizenship requirements of all vessel owners seeking a Fisheries endorsement. In addition, the changes to citizenship requirements for Mortgages under this same endorsement will be implemented some time mid-2003.

» As of January 1999, the National Vessel Documentation Center office has not been accepting the old applications dated 1992. Before using your forms check the upper left hand corner. You should be using the 1997 version.

» Citizenship requirements have changed dramatically in the last several years. Pleasure vessels can now be operated by non-US Citizens. Please give us a call so we can help you through the finer details of these changes.
